Hikers and Backpackers: Luxury Condos at Hostel Prices

Ready to hit the road? Excited for the new trip that have been planned but financially low? That's ok. If you spent hours for online mapping out the $15 hostels on your vacation route but failed to see any, then don't put your self into dismay. You're not even looking forward to sleeping on lumpy cots with strangers but at least to the place where the price is right.

Maybe there's an alternative like a 7 nights in a 4 or 5 Star Luxury Condo for only 100 dollars. Yes, that works out to around 15 bucks a night. Sounds good to be true right? But it is.

There's a dirty little secret in the timeshare industry that nobody is talking about you'll want to find out about before your next excursion.

There's more unbooked weeks every year than resevered weeks. That's a typical timeshare scenario. That means that the condo owners is losing their money. that's when the "something is better than nothing" axiom comes into play.

The owners are willing to give high discounts just to fill the emplty weeks. Deals can be as good as 90% off! MEaning you can get a luxury condo for only 100 dollars for a week instead of the typical 15 000 dollar in timeshare fees.

The best of all, these deals are available in all the popular travel destinations around the world and for more than 2 million weeks available each year.

Now, why settle for lumpy cots and community showers?

Do a little research on the net, you'll save big and vacation in luxury on a hostel budget. Search for "hot Weeks" "Discount Condos" and other terms.
